Implications of neutrino masses and mixing for weak processes

We present a general theory of weak processes involving neutrinos which consistently incorporates the possibility of nonzero neutrino masses and associated lepton mixing. The theory leads to new tests for and bounds on such masses and mixing. These tests make use of (..pi..,K)/sub l/2 decay, nuclear ..beta.. decay, and ..mu.. and tau decays, among others. New experiments at SIN and KEK to apply our tests are mentioned. We further discuss some implications for: (1) the analysis of the spectral parameters in leptonic decays to determine the Lorentz structure of the weak leptonic couplings; (2) fundamental weak interaction constants such as G/sub ..mu../, G'/sub V/, f/sub ..pi../, f/sub K/, F/sub u/q, q = d or s, m/sub W/, and m/sub Z/; and (3) neutrino propagation.
